Latest Patents

Tammy holds a patent for "Chromium oxide compositions containing zinc, their preparation and their use as catalysts and catalyst precursors." This invention describes a chromium-containing catalyst comprising both ZnCrO and crystalline α-chromium oxide. Her composition includes between about 10 atom percent and 67 atom percent of chromium and contains at least about 70 atom percent of zinc. Notably, at least 90 atom percent of the chromium present as chromium oxide is incorporated as ZnCrO or crystalline α-chromium oxide. Additionally, the patent details a method for preparing the composition and a process for manipulating fluorine distribution in halogenated hydrocarbons using her catalyst.
